Output ebde76a396683388b9baf7792fb23a3c09f3ed4a697b354fa45cfb43c55e6ce2:0

value
1820000
script pubkey
OP_0 OP_PUSHBYTES_32 74561e20ce98985c57f43b5445449b6876a4e8ad56670c15fa4c628c047ee263
address
tb1qw3tpugxwnzv9c4l58d2y23ymdpm2f69d2ensc906f33gcpr7uf3sc2py4j
transaction
ebde76a396683388b9baf7792fb23a3c09f3ed4a697b354fa45cfb43c55e6ce2
confirmations
32968
spent
false

2 Sat Ranges